#090797 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#090797 is composed of 3.5% red, 2.7%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94% cyan, 95.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 240.8 degrees, a saturation of 91.1% and a lightness of 31%. #090797 color hex could be obtained by blending #120eff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

Shades and Tints of #090797
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#eeedf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#090797
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a4a54 is the less saturated color, while #03019d is the most saturated one.
